Beijing (Gasgoo)- ModelBest, an AI-focused technology company, recently announced the completion of a new financing round, which raised for the company several hundreds of millions of yuan. The funding will expedite the company's efforts to commercialize efficient AI large models, particularly in edge computing applications.  

Founded in August 2022, ModelBest has previously secured tens of millions of yuan in angel funding in April 2023 and another significant funding round worth hundreds of millions of yuan in April 2024.  

ModelBest has distinguished itself as an innovator in AI large model technology and its practical applications. In November 2023, the company publicly launched its multimodal large model service, Luca. This was followed by the February 2024 release of the open-source edge-side model, MiniCPM.

MiniCPM integrates capabilities such as unlimited text processing, ultra-clear OCR, and real-time video understanding into edge devices for the first time, achieving over 3 million downloads since its debut.  

ModelBest's business portfolio now spans AI phones, AI PCs, intelligent cockpits, smart homes, and embodied robotics, through partnerships with industry leaders such as Huawei, MediaTek, Lenovo, Intel, Great Wall Motor, and Yeelight. Notably, ModelBest signed a strategic cooperation agreement with Great Wall Motor in September 2024 to develop AI large model applications in the automotive sector.
